Put the Royal Gorilla into a bigger pot now I have room in a taller tent. She's been put in to a 12.5l airpot, I'm hoping that will be bug enough for the entire grow as I know autos don't like repotting. Growth seems to have really slowed down this week, I'm hoping it's just a case of all the hard works going on in the soil and I'll see the results above ground soon enough. Week 4 and the Royal Gorilla is starting to up its growth rate, looking really healthy and loving the new higher temperatures from last weeks heater. Up to about 4.5" and a lovely green colouring to the leaves. Starting a weekly Crop Guard SM spray now, no sign of mites but prevention is definitely better than cure when it comes to spider mites. Have now started a bit of LST on day 24 just some tying down and leaf tucking, getting some light to lower nodes and she seems to be responding well.

Being a total novice when it comes to autos I was wondering should I top her soon, leave it a while or not top at all? I keep reading conflicting reports so thought I'd ask actually growers. Thanks in advance :)
Solved
Techniques. Defoliation
likes
Stick
Stickanswered grow question 6 years ago
Hi @Undercovergrower! If it's your first time with autos, you might consider letting the plant grow in its natural shape with no HST operations such as topping or fimming. LST works well with autos but HST manipulations usually stunt the growth for a week or more. Remember with autos, loosing time is loosing yield. However if you're confident about this and if you're not hurry to smoke your buds, you can try to top her at the 3rd node after the 4th node has developed. This way, you loose a part of the plant, but the recovery / new growth happens much faster. Hope this will help, keep us up-to-date and happy growing 👊

Hi guys any advice for me, yellowing leaves getting worse and dark purple stems. Upped my bloom nutes a bit but no benefit yet. Any ideas?
Solved
Other. Other
likes
mad_scientist
mad_scientistanswered grow question 6 years ago
Hello @Undercovergrower ! What you have there is nitrogen and phosphorus deficiencies.The purple stems and petioles can be occurred from many different things so its not very reliable indicator. Ideally the nitrogen deficiency should start at around week 8 but that's not a big problem, the problem is the phosphorus deficiency . The fact that you have a phosphorus deficiency so soon tells me that your plant didn't develop its buds at its full potential. Anyway, since your are at week 8 there is no need to raise the grow nutrients. What you can do is to raise the bio bloom. A dosage of 1 ml/l bio bloom for this stage of flowering is very very low even if you were using all mix. Raise it at 4 ml/l for 1 maybe 2 weeks and then flush.
